The Free State allrounder, Miané Smit, is geared for her potential senior international debut during the Proteas Women’s tour to Sri Lanka.
South Africa will face Sri Lanka and India in a One-Day International Tri-Series in Colombo in preparation for the ICC Women’s Cricket World Cup.
The 20-year-old Smit is one of three uncapped players in the squad, albeit she was a traveling reserve during last year’s ICC Women’s T20 World Cup in the UAE.
Smit, who was named as Free State Cricket’s Women’s Player of the Year last week, told OFM Sport that she is excited and ready.
